Discover Bundaberg and the Fraser Coast
Bundaberg is where the coastline meets the country, four hours' drive north of Brisbane. It is the gateway to the Southern Great Barrier Reef and boasts excellent shopping, sporting, cultural, education and tourism facilities including Mon Repos Turtle Rookery. The Fraser Coast is known for its diverse, natural landscapes and laid-back lifestyle. This destination with a difference is home to K'gari (Formerly Fraser Island), incredible whale watching encounters, family-friendly beaches, history and culture.
